Output 7fe5d94eb7839f66429f434a00bc6f6c92d0ffe0404866202300842bd7478e50:2

value
84840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a96b47183888c4a783fc55c0f6be32d9b84ac6 OP_EQUAL
address
34rHrWRq2jR6QkvsnmkGs9CB6tVxJ9BU9z
transaction
7fe5d94eb7839f66429f434a00bc6f6c92d0ffe0404866202300842bd7478e50
confirmations
531036
spent
true